news 2026/6/9 21:05:36

从零开始构建专属AI虚拟主播:本地化部署完整指南

作者头像

张小明

前端开发工程师

1.2k 24
文章封面图
从零开始构建专属AI虚拟主播:本地化部署完整指南

从零开始构建专属AI虚拟主播:本地化部署完整指南

【免费下载链接】NeuroA recreation of Neuro-Sama originally created in 7 days.项目地址: https://gitcode.com/gh_mirrors/neuro6/Neuro

想要拥有一个能够实时互动、个性鲜明的AI虚拟主播吗?无需复杂的技术背景,只需一台普通电脑,你就能打造完全自主掌控的数字角色。本文将带你逐步掌握本地AI虚拟主播系统的完整搭建流程。

🎯 为什么选择本地AI虚拟主播系统?

在云端AI服务盛行的今天,本地化部署方案展现出独特的优势:

隐私安全保障:所有对话数据和处理过程都在本地完成,彻底杜绝信息泄露风险零延迟实时交互:本地计算确保语音识别和角色响应的即时性完全免费使用:开源协议保障长期免费,无任何隐藏费用高度个性化定制:从角色外观到对话风格,完全按照你的喜好设定

🛠️ 核心技术模块解析

智能语音交互引擎

项目通过stt.py实现高质量的语音识别功能,能够准确捕捉用户语音指令。同时,tts.py模块提供自然流畅的语音合成输出,让虚拟主播的声音更加生动真实。

角色动画控制系统

上图展示了Neuro系统的实际运行效果——一个功能完善的AI虚拟主播直播界面。界面采用二次元设计风格,左侧为互动历史记录,中央显示虚拟角色形象,右侧为实时聊天面板。这种布局设计既保证了视觉美观度,又确保了功能实用性。

多平台直播集成

系统内置了modules/discordClient.py和modules/twitchClient.py等客户端模块,支持虚拟主播在多个平台同步直播互动。

🚀 快速部署实战指南

环境准备与项目获取

首先需要获取项目源代码:

git clone https://gitcode.com/gh_mirrors/neuro6/Neuro

然后安装必要的依赖包:

cd Neuro pip install -r requirements.txt

核心配置文件详解

项目提供了Neuro.yaml配置文件,包含以下关键设置项:

配置类别主要参数功能说明
音频设备输入/输出设备选择参考utils/listAudioDevices.py进行设备识别
AI模型语言模型参数控制对话质量和响应速度
角色设定个性特征配置定义虚拟主播的行为模式

个性化角色定制

通过修改modules/customPrompt.py中的提示词模板,你可以为AI角色注入独特的个性:

  • 活泼可爱型:适合娱乐直播场景
  • 知识渊博型:适合教育科普内容
  • 温柔体贴型:适合情感陪伴应用

💡 实际应用场景深度探索

个人虚拟主播运营

对于想要尝试虚拟直播的个人用户,Neuro系统提供了完整的解决方案。通过简单的配置调整,你就能拥有一个能够实时响应观众互动的AI主播,无需额外雇佣中之人。

智能语音助手开发

除了直播场景,系统还可以作为本地智能语音助手使用。项目支持长期记忆功能,能够记录用户的偏好和对话历史,让AI助手的表现更加个性化。

🔧 性能优化与问题排查

硬件配置建议

根据实际测试经验,推荐以下硬件配置:

  • CPU:4核以上处理器,确保流畅运行
  • 内存:8GB RAM以上,支持多任务处理
  • 存储空间:预留2-5GB用于模型文件存储

常见问题解决方案

音频设备识别问题: 使用系统提供的utils/listAudioDevices.py工具列出可用设备,确保正确配置输入输出设备。

响应延迟优化: 通过调整Neuro.yaml中的模型参数,可以在保证质量的前提下显著提升响应速度。

📊 功能扩展与二次开发

模块化架构优势

Neuro采用高度模块化的设计理念,每个功能都独立封装:

  • 语言模型封装:llmWrappers/目录提供多种AI模型接口
  • 记忆管理系统:memories/模块实现对话持久化存储
  • 多模态支持:通过llmWrappers/imageLLMWrapper.py实现图像理解能力

自定义功能开发

开发者可以基于现有架构轻松添加新功能。项目结构清晰,代码注释完整,便于进行二次开发和功能扩展。

🎨 用户体验优化技巧

角色形象设计建议

  • 视觉风格统一:保持角色外观与界面设计风格的一致性
  • 表情动作丰富:利用系统支持的动画功能增强表现力
  • 语音语调匹配:确保合成语音与角色设定的性格特征相符

互动流程优化

通过合理配置对话流程和响应机制,可以显著提升用户与虚拟主播的互动体验。

🔮 技术发展趋势展望

随着硬件性能的持续提升和AI模型的不断优化,本地AI虚拟主播技术将迎来新的发展机遇:

  • 实时性进一步提升:更低的延迟带来更自然的交互体验
  • 个性化程度加深:更加精准的角色行为控制和情感表达
  • 应用场景扩展:从娱乐直播向教育、客服、陪伴等更多领域延伸

💫 总结与入门建议

Neuro项目为想要探索本地AI虚拟主播技术的开发者提供了理想的起点。其开源特性、模块化设计和优秀的性能表现,让每个人都能在普通硬件上体验到先进的AI交互技术。

给新手的实用建议

  1. 先从基础配置开始,逐步深入高级功能
  2. 参考项目文档和社区经验,避免重复踩坑
  3. 根据实际需求进行功能定制,不要盲目追求复杂配置

无论你是想要打造个人虚拟主播,还是开发智能语音助手,Neuro都值得深入探索和实践。开始你的AI虚拟主播之旅吧!

【免费下载链接】NeuroA recreation of Neuro-Sama originally created in 7 days.项目地址: https://gitcode.com/gh_mirrors/neuro6/Neuro

创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

版权声明: 本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:809451989@qq.com进行投诉反馈,一经查实,立即删除!
网站建设 2026/6/9 18:50:08

MyBatisPlus和IndexTTS2看似无关?其实都在提升开发效率

MyBatisPlus 与 IndexTTS2:看似无关,实则同源 在一次深夜调试语音客服系统的经历中,我盯着屏幕上那串由 IndexTTS2 合成的音频波形图,耳边回响着略带“温柔”情感模式的机械女声播报用户订单信息。突然意识到——这声音背后&#…

作者头像 李华
网站建设 2026/6/9 18:48:29

WMI Explorer终极指南:5分钟快速上手Windows系统管理神器

WMI Explorer终极指南:5分钟快速上手Windows系统管理神器 【免费下载链接】wmie2 项目地址: https://gitcode.com/gh_mirrors/wm/wmie2 WMI Explorer是一款专为Windows系统管理设计的可视化工具,能够高效浏览和查询WMI命名空间、类、实例及属性信…

作者头像 李华
网站建设 2026/6/9 18:48:13

揭秘Warp中间件开发:5个高效实战技巧深度解析

揭秘Warp中间件开发:5个高效实战技巧深度解析 【免费下载链接】warp A super-easy, composable, web server framework for warp speeds. 项目地址: https://gitcode.com/gh_mirrors/war/warp Warp是一个超快速、可组合的Rust Web服务器框架,其独…

作者头像 李华
网站建设 2026/6/9 7:58:04

5个策略解决开源项目版本兼容性难题:从理论到实战

5个策略解决开源项目版本兼容性难题:从理论到实战 【免费下载链接】bootstrap-select 项目地址: https://gitcode.com/gh_mirrors/boo/bootstrap-select 在现代前端开发中,依赖管理已成为项目维护的核心挑战之一。以 Bootstrap-select 项目为例&…

作者头像 李华
网站建设 2026/6/9 20:04:04

Obsidian字体优化终极指南:打造舒适阅读体验的完整方案

Obsidian字体优化终极指南:打造舒适阅读体验的完整方案 【免费下载链接】awesome-obsidian 🕶️ Awesome stuff for Obsidian 项目地址: https://gitcode.com/gh_mirrors/aw/awesome-obsidian 在Obsidian中进行知识管理时,字体优化是提…

作者头像 李华
网站建设 2026/6/9 20:04:26

RX-Explorer完全手册:重新塑造Windows文件管理新范式

RX-Explorer完全手册:重新塑造Windows文件管理新范式 【免费下载链接】RX-Explorer 一款优雅的UWP文件管理器 | An elegant UWP Explorer 项目地址: https://gitcode.com/gh_mirrors/rx/RX-Explorer 在数字化工作日益普及的今天,高效的文件管理已…

作者头像 李华